What does kindness look like? Little Nina is on a mission to find out, and she’s inviting young readers to join her on a joyful journey through her neighborhood—backpack packed, heart wide open, and eyes ready to spot Kind wherever it might be hiding.
From beloved performer and LGBTQ+ advocate Nina West comes this exuberant celebration of kindness in all its forms. As Nina explores her community, she discovers something wonderful: kindness isn’t just one thing. It’s helping a neighbor, sharing a smile, standing up for a friend—and most importantly, it’s being your authentic, magnificent self. Because the most special kind of Kind? That’s the you kind of Kind.
This vibrant picture book does something magical. It teaches children that self-love and loving others aren’t separate lessons—they’re beautifully intertwined. With playful, inventive language that begs to be read aloud (yes, “WUZZFASTIC” is now part of your vocabulary), the story creates a safe, joyful space for conversations about identity, acceptance, and what it means to show up as yourself in the world.
